Decoding Your Solar Inverter's Language

Modern inverters like those from EK SOLAR's X-Series display multiple voltage measurements:

Display Type Normal Range What's Measured
DC Input Voltage 300-600V Raw power from solar panels
AC Output Voltage 220-240V Usable electricity for appliances

FAQ: Inverter Voltage Basics

What's normal voltage for home solar systems?

Most residential systems operate between 300-480V DC input, converting to 220-240V AC output.

Can voltage readings predict panel failure?

Yes! Gradual voltage decreases often indicate aging panels or connection issues before complete failure occurs.
